    1. When creating VPCs and VSwitches, you have to specify the private IP address range for the VPC in the form of a Classless Inter-Domain Routing (CIDR) block. Private IP address range of VPC Use 192.168.0.0/16, 172.16.0.0/12, and 10.0.0.0/8 or their subsets as the private IP address range for your VPC. Note the following when planning the private IP address range of VPC: If you have only one VPC and it does not have to communicate with a local data center, you are free to use any of the preceding IP address ranges or their subnets. If you have multiple VPCs, or you want to build a hybrid cloud composed of one or more VPCs and local data centers, we recommend that you use a subset of these standard IP address ranges as the IP address range for your VPC and make sure that the netmask is no larger than /16. You also need to consider whether the classic network is used when selecting a VPC CIDR block. If you plan to connect ECS instances in a classic network with a VPC, we recommend that you do not use the IP address range 10.0.0.0/8, which is also used by the classic network.
